How they compare
Kenya currently reports 8,402 t against 4,628 t in Saudi Arabia, a difference of 3,774 t.
That makes Kenya's figure about 1.8 times Saudi Arabia's.
The two have swapped places 6 times across 20 shared years of data; in 2002 it was Kenya ahead.
Kenya ranks 60th and Saudi Arabia ranks 63rd of 165 countries.
Across the 3 decades both report, Kenya averaged higher in 2 and Saudi Arabia in 1.
Head to head by decade
| Decade | Kenya | Saudi Arabia | Difference | Ahead |
|---|---|---|---|---|
| 2000s | 61,390 t | 4,554 t | 56,836 t | Kenya |
| 2010s | 28,224 t | 3,909 t | 24,315 t | Kenya |
| 2020s | 3,615 t | 6,095 t | 2,480 t | Saudi Arabia |
Averages of every year both report within each decade.

About this data
The Fertilizers by Product dataset contains information on the Production, Trade and Agriculture Use of inorganic (chemical or mineral) fertilizers products. The fertilizer statistics data are for a set of 23 product categories. Both straight and compound fertilizers are included.
